Cambium Learning® Group is an award-winning educational technology solutions leader dedicated to helping all students reach their potential through individualized and differentiated instruction. Using a research-based, personalized approach, Cambium Learning Group delivers SaaS resources and instructional products that engage students and support teachers in fun, positive, safe and scalable environments. These solutions are provided through Learning A-Z® (online differentiated instruction for elementary school reading, writing and science), ExploreLearning® (online interactive math and science simulations, a math fact fluency solution, and a K–2 science solution), Voyager Sopris Learning® (blended solutions that accelerate struggling learners to achieve in literacy and math and professional development for teachers), and VKidz Learning (online comprehensive homeschool education and programs for literacy and science). Job Overview:

The Senior Managing Editor, Content and Test Development provides strategic and operational leadership for assessment content and production editorial teams. Accountable for editorial quality across the full assessment lifecycle—from item development through final production, including ancillary materials—while advancing AI-enabled editorial workflows to improve efficiency, consistency, and scalability.

Job Responsibilities:

Editorial Leadership

  • Lead, mentor, and develop a multidisciplinary team of assessment content and production editors, including workload planning, cross-training, and performance coaching.

  • Establish clear workflows and handoffs between content, production, and editorial teams; provide escalation support on complex style and content issues.

Assessment Content Editing

  • Oversee editorial review of test items, passages, graphics, item development plans, performance-level descriptors, manuals, and technical documentation.

  • Enforce Chicago, APA, and AP style alongside state-specific style guides.

Production Editing & QA

  • Direct production editing for paper-based and digital materials: test books, ancillary materials, reports, and operational documentation.

  • Oversee proofreading, version control, and final quality checks prior to release or submission.

AI-Enabled Editorial Innovation

  • Lead responsible adoption of AI tools (e.g., Copilot, Claude, Grammarly Business, Writer) for copyediting, style compliance, and QA while preserving human editorial judgment.

  • Assist in the development of internal guidelines for ethical, secure AI use, train editors on consistent tool usage.

  • Implement workflow automation (e.g., Power Automate, SharePoint) and AI-powered document comparison for version control and error detection.

Operations & Collaboration

  • Design scalable workflows supporting high-volume, concurrent deadlines; track quality and turnaround metrics to drive continuous improvement.

  • Contribute editorial expertise to proposals, staffing models, and resourcing plans. Serve as a trusted editorial advisor to leadership, project teams, and clients.

Job Requirements:

  • Master's degree in English, Journalism, Communications, or related field.

  • 15+ years of professional editing experience, including educational assessment, test development, or complex technical publishing.

  • Demonstrated people management experience in deadline-driven environments.

  • Exceptional command of Chicago, APA, and AP style; experience editing assessment items, technical reports, and high-stakes testing content.

  • Proven experience using AI tools to support and improve editorial workflows.

  • Strong organizational, communication, and decision-making skills; flexibility during peak production periods

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
